This episode is a conversation with Lauren Ciborowski, Duncan Yozzo and Zubin Mehta , all juniors at SMU COX, who over the years have struck me as having a solid point of view, knowing their purpose and living their values. They talk about key influences in their life, what shaped their decisions and what they have learned about themselves in college. This conversation has made me feel like I am around the kitchen table just having a chat over pizza.
Key takeaways:
- Zubin talked about Practice, Practice, Practice: consistency is key to good communication. And if you want people to care, then show them you care.
- Duncan: Gen Z knows when they are being marketed to and will push back unless marketers are genuine in their marketing
- Lauren spoke about how one of the hardest challenges is when you say yes to many things, learning to prioritize and focus is key learning in college.
